Former Everton and Northern Ireland midfielder Bryan Hamilton is our co-commentator for Saturday’s Premier League fixture at Carrow Road.

Hamilton, who joined the Blues from Ipswich Town in 1975 and played 54 games, scoring 5 goals, will join regular commentator Darren Griffiths on evertonfc.com from 3pm.

“I’m really looking forward to it,” said Hamilton. “It’s a while since I have seen the Blues live and it’s a football club that I still have a lot of affection for. It’s a big game, too.”

After leaving Goodison, Hamilton had spells with Millwall, Swindon Town and Tranmere Rovers before embarking on a long managerial career with Tranmere, Wigan Athletic (twice), Leicester City, Northern Ireland and Saturday’s opponents Norwich City.

His time at Everton will always be remembered, of course, for the ‘goal’ that never was, when he turned a Ronny Goodlass cross past Liverpool goalkeeper Ray Clemence towards the end of the 1977 FA Cup semi-final at Maine Road.

Referee Clive Thomas inexplicably disallowed the effort and he still hasn’t been forgiven by Evertonians of a certain generation!

“I’m looking forward to some interaction with the supporters on Saturday and I am sure that semi-final will crop up….it always does!” quipped Hamilton.
